Output 7cf60d115d2ecd958b0bfed33c546fc4b9789ae4c30af6691d16a641ca3a0365:117

value
75619708
script pubkey
OP_0 OP_PUSHBYTES_20 1ab41aaa92cd73c04fac3dce2882dd559c405542
address
bc1qr26p425je4euqnav8h8z3qka2kwyq42z7k8hpl
transaction
7cf60d115d2ecd958b0bfed33c546fc4b9789ae4c30af6691d16a641ca3a0365
spent
true